With the successor to SpillGuard, SpillGuard connect, Denios has launched a new product that integrates spill trays into a company network, bringing the storage of hazardous substances into the digital age. In addition to a visual and audible alarm, the new leakage warning system also sends a message in real time to an end device of choice (smartphone, tablet, desktop PC) in the event of contact with liquid hazardous substances.
Users are thus automatically shown in which drip tray a leak has occurred and can initiate measures more quickly. The device can be installed in any drip tray, works autonomously and offers an unlimited range with a battery life of up to 5 years.
Reliable and centralized remote monitoring of the spill trays equipped with SpillGuard connect is carried out via the Denios connect web application. This makes it easy to manage multiple detectors, displaying status data such as ambient temperature and battery charge status. At the same time, the operating status is documented once a week, which can be submitted as a PDF report during an audit for the weekly prescribed visual inspection of spill trays in accordance with the Steel Tray Directive (StawaR) / TRGS 510.
